**Q: A deep link opens the Fernwick app but lands on a blank screen — what gives?**

Nine times out of ten the route table in Pathloom is stale, so the app can't match the link to a screen. Kick the route-sync job, wait a minute, and retry the link. If it's still blank, it's probably a malformed link from marketing. The full debugging flow lives on the page below.

dashboard of yahaf-kajep = https://jira.zemvarsys.internal/display/projects/browse/browse/a08b

# Runbook: Hunting leaked file descriptors in Quillgate

When the `fd_open` gauge climbs steadily between deploys, suspect a leak rather than load. First confirm on a single pod: exec in and count entries under `/proc/1/fd`, noting how many are sockets in CLOSE_WAIT versus regular files. Capture two snapshots ten minutes apart before restarting anything — we need the delta for the postmortem. Reproduce locally with the Marbury load harness, which requires the service running with the following configuration values.

settings of yagep-bajog:
[istdor]
port = 4000
region = south-2
host = istdor.qorvelcorp.internal
timeout_ms = 5000
retries = 5

14:22 — Sweeper deep-dive. Turns out the retention sweeper on the Bramblefield cluster had been skipping the archive tier for three days because of a stale cursor. New folks: this is why we always check cursor age first. Marek rolled the hotfix and re-ran the sweep manually. The exact build we deployed is identified by the token below.

build token for kagaf-hahof: htk14_9d3d4d26d7d8de

Quarterly Planning Note — Customer Concentration

Finance team: Dellhurst Components now accounts for 46% of Q2 revenue, up from 31%. Single-customer exposure above 40% breaches our internal threshold. Actions: cap further volume commitments to Dellhurst pending review; accelerate the Ostmere and Carrowline pipelines; model a 12-month wind-down scenario. Payment terms with Dellhurst stay at 60 days — monitor weekly. Reforecast due end of month. The confidential note on business plans appears directly below this line.

internal memo for kaduf-baduf: Only 35 of the 378 pilot accounts renewed Holir, so a churn review is set for June 11. Eliielax Group is in early talks to buy Silaelix Group for about $142.1 million.